W210 & Power Steering
My 2003 E320 Wagon is low on hydraulic power steering fluid (the tank beside the windshield washer fluid tank,on the driver's side). I see the proper fluid is Fuchs Titan,#001 989 20 03. To bring it up over the "min" line,can I simply add to what's there or should I drain,flush and refill?? I'm hoping to just add fluid to what is already there. Any advice?? Thanks.
|
If the fluid is low it must have gone somewhere, I suspect one of your accumulators for the load leveling has developed an internal leak. The load leveling and steering share the same fluid.
|
Get it on a lift and inspect in the area of the rack for leaks. Seems that the o-rings that are used where the hoses connect to the rack go bad after a period of time. There is an o-ring kit available for the application. With that said I have spoken with a few folks that have used pwr strg fluid with stop leak and it did stop the leakage.
